Ask before you book

A clinic that answers these clearly is a different proposition from one that deflects. Take the list with you.

  1. 1Which specific product do you use, and is it my own tissue or a purchased donor product?
  2. 2Is it being used as a 361 HCT/P, or under an FDA investigational new drug application?
  3. 3Who performs the injection: the physician of record, or a PA or nurse practitioner?
  4. 4What is the total cost, and what happens if a second treatment is needed?
  5. 5What outcome data do you keep on your own patients for my specific condition?
  6. 6How many of these have you done for this indication, and what does a poor result look like?

What it is likely to cost

UW Health | Carbone Cancer Center Stem Cell Transplant and Cellular Therapy has not published pricing, which is true of almost every clinic in this category. Insurance almost never covers the injection itself, though the consultation, imaging and any conventional treatment in the same visit often are covered.

Ask for the total in writing, including whether a second injection is billed separately, and ask for the CPT codes so you can check coverage yourself before you commit.
